“Cherry Whip” Goods from Bocchi the Rock! Featuring Namori’s New Chibi Art Launch

A new merchandise lineup from the anime Bocchi the Rock! has launched under the theme “Cherry Whip,” featuring freshly illustrated chibi artwork by Namori. The collection leans into a dessert-inspired motif with cherries and whipped cream, and it is now available online via Curtain Damashii.

Event Information

  • Sales format: Online sales
  • Start date/time: Feb 4, 2026 (Wed) 12:00 (JST)
  • Where to buy: Curtain Damashii (Online)
  • Illustration: Newly drawn chibi art by Namori

Goods

  • Acrylic Stand (7 designs)
    Sheet size: approx. 13cm (L) × 7cm (S) / Thickness: 3mm
  • Acrylic Keyholder (7 designs)
    Size: approx. 7cm (L) × 5cm (S)
  • Trading Can Badge (7 designs)
    Diameter: approx. 57mm
  • Muffler Towel (1 design)
    Size: approx. 110cm (L) × 20cm (S)
  • Rubber Mat (2 designs)
    Size: approx. 60cm (L) × 35cm (S) / Thickness: 2mm
  • Tote Bag (1 design)
    Size: approx. 37cm (H) × 36cm (W) × 10cm (Gusset)
  • Card Sleeves (2 designs)
    Standard size: 67mm × 92mm / 65 sleeves per set
